Apple Unveils iOS 13: Dark Mode, Enhanced Siri, and More

Apple has unveiled iOS 13, bringing a host of new features and improvements to iPhone users. Among the highlights are a dramatic new look with Dark Mode, enhanced Siri capabilities, and significant updates to several built-in apps. Dark Mode, a highly anticipated feature, transforms the look of iOS with a dramatic new dark colour scheme. It's designed to be easier on the eyes in low-light environments and offers a more immersive experience when viewing photos and using apps. CarPlay, Apple's in-car infotainment system, gets a revamped Dashboard that provides more relevant information at a glance. It also gains Siri support for third-party navigation and audio apps, allowing users to control their favourite services directly from their car's display. Siri, Apple's virtual assistant, receives a significant upgrade with a new, more natural voice. It also introduces Suggested Automations, which learn from users' routines and suggest automations based on their habits. HomePod, Apple's smart speaker, gains voice recognition for personal requests. It can now distinguish between different users in the household and offer a more personalized experience. Additionally, a new sleep timer feature allows users to set a specific time for the speaker to turn off, perfect for bedtime listening. Messages, Apple's built-in messaging app, now automatically shares a user's name and photo or Memoji in Messages threads. This makes conversations more personal and helps users identify who they're chatting with. The Photos app in iOS 13 offers easier browsing with a new tab for days, months, and years. It also introduces powerful editing tools, allowing users to make adjustments to their photos with just a tap. AirPods users can now have Siri read their incoming messages aloud. Additionally, a new audio sharing feature allows two sets of AirPods to listen to the same audio simultaneously. iOS 13 also introduces fast, easy, and private Sign In with Apple, a new way to sign in to apps and websites using your Apple ID. It allows users to use their Apple ID to sign in with just a tap, and it's designed to keep users' data private. The Reminders app receives a new look and offers intelligent ways to create and edit reminders. It can suggest times, dates, and places based on the user's input, making it easier to set reminders on the go. Lastly, iOS 13 features an all-new Maps experience. It includes broader road coverage, improved address accuracy, and a new way to share ETA with friends and family. iOS 13 brings a wealth of new features and improvements to iPhone users. From the dramatic new look of Dark Mode to the enhanced capabilities of Siri and the revamped Maps app, there's plenty to look forward to in Apple's latest mobile operating system. Many of these features are set to roll out later this year, with additional language support for Siri's latest voice and personality features planned for the future.
